Words to Ponder 17

Annihilate(verb) = completely destroy

Illicit drugs annihilate your body.

------------------------------------

Brandish (verb) = to wave or swing something in a threatening manner

You won't make me feel threatened by brandishing your sword.

-------------------------------------

Browbeat (verb) = to use threats or angry speech to make someone do or accept something

I don't know what satisfaction he gets by browbeating others.

--------------------------------------

Conflagration (noun) = large destructive fire

The conflagration in Aurora killed three people.

--------------------------------------

Lecherous (adj) = related to lust

Parental guidance is necessary for children who are watching television as to avoid their viewing of lecherous shows.

-------------------------------------

Detonation (noun) = explosion

The detonation of the home-made bomb in an area in Cotabato killed seven people.

-------------------------------------

Foment (verb) = to incite something such as rebellion and the like

Incarcerate (verb) = imprison

The Spaniards incarcerated those who attempted to foment a revolution

--------------------------------------

Fulminate (verb) = to complain loudly or angrily

He keeps on fulminating about the plan of the government to increase the tax in cigarettes and liquors.

-------------------------------------

Fracas (noun) = a noisy argument

Every day I have to endure the fracas between my two neighbors.

--------------------------------------

Loath (adj) = reluctant

I am loath to apply in that company.

-------------------------------------

Truculent (adj) = easily angered or annoyed, and likely to argue

I don't want to be with Lisa as she's so truculent.
